[Note Guidelines] Photographer's Note |
This is the beautiful Mudjimba Beach. You can see the cute little Mudjimba island, also known as 'Old Woman' island in the distance.
I snapped the photo just at right time to catch the surfer riding the wave.
The power, textures and beauty of waves are incredible and it is truly amazing how their tidal movement is influenced by the moon's gravitational pull.
This photo was taken at dusk, so the colours were warm. I slightly enhanced them and "warmed" them even more using tone adjustment and colour balance. |
